Why is my Air Conditioner Freezing Up?

August 24, 2016

A freeze up during cooling season is when a layer of ice forms on the inside coil of your AC unit. Sometimes it can freeze all the way along the refrigerant lines to the outdoor unit. The ice buildup on your AC unit creates an inability to cool effectively. It also puts stress on the…

What is a Heat Pump?

April 14, 2016

A heat pump is a device that transfers heat from one place to another, from in to out or from out to in. In the winter it works like a heater, extracting heat energy from outside and transferring it inside. In the summer the process reverses and it will remove heat from your home and…
